Barça eyeing Brazil’s next prodigy

Xavi Hernández wants to strengthen the offensive line next season with young talent, and the chosen one is, like Endrick, one of the youngest Brazilian talents.

There’s still half a season left before the end of the 2022-23 calendar, but Barcelona don’t want to wait to work on their future squad.

Xavi Hernández and his team are looking for talented candidates to eventually play alongside Robert Lewandowski, Ousmane Dembélé, and co., as the team will need plenty of options up front given the number of official games in the soccer calendar.

The Catalan giants were undoubtedly one of the teams with the most complete offensive line. Still, some players ended up leaving, like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ang, and some others like Raphinha, Ansu Fati, and Ferran Torres haven’t performed as expected.

Barça looking for ‘their Endrick’

Els Blaugranes are also interested in rejuvenating their squad, as their archrivals Real Madrid are doing with the signings of Vinicius, Rodrygo, and now Endrick in the attack.

The Catalans, who have been prevented from signing any players in the January transfer window by La Liga’s Financial Fair Play regulations, have set their sights on Atletico Paranaense talent Vitor Roque as one of their possible additions for the summer, according to Catalan sports newspaper Sport.

After not being able to land Endrick, Barça are determined to sign Roque, although many big European teams are also willing to include the Brazilian prodigy to their squads, including Real Madrid and PSG.

The 17-year-old rising star, currently playing at the U20 Sudamericano tournament in Colombia, has often been compared to Luis Suárez due to his strength and ability to score.
